U.S. patent number D954,706 [Application Number D/758,909] was granted by the patent office on 2022-06-14 for solid state drive memory device.
This patent grant is currently assigned to SAMSUNG ELECTRONICS CO., LTD.. The grantee listed for this patent is SAMSUNG ELECTRONICS CO., LTD.. Invention is credited to Hyung-Sup Shim.
